Industrial heritage is an important part of China's cultural heritage.Under the general background of urban economic structural transformation and incremental development to stock development,the reuse of industrial wasteland,industrial enterprise transformation,and industrial building reconstruction have become the development of urban renewal and development.Important content and driving force,under this development trend,the protection and utilization of industrial heritage has become a hot topic in recent years.Different types of industrial heritage protection and utilization methods have universal methods.However,due to the individual characteristics of the industrial heritage and the development characteristics of the city where it is located,adaptive strategies should also be proposed in the process of protection and utilization.Therefore,this article studies the protection and utilization of specific types of industrial heritage(coal mine industrial heritage)in typical cities(Zaozhuang)to enrich relevant theoretical research results and also provide theoretical basis for urban development planning.The concept of "heritage corridor" is a regional and global protection strategy dedicated to large-scale,linear heritage,involving multiple elements such as culture,nature,and humanities in urban development.It is a new idea for current research on the protection and use of heritage and the theoretical source of this study.Based on this,this paper takes the coal mine industrial heritage of the Zaozhuang section of the Jinpu Railway as the starting point,combs the characteristics and connections between the elements of the "heritage corridor" system,and then proposes the renewal strategy and reuse model of the coordinated urban development of the Zaozhuang coal mine industrial heritage.This article is problem-oriented,starting from several aspects of "problem analysis-theoretical exploration-pattern construction-strategy proposal".Problem analysis: By investigating the current situation of industrial heritage protection,China is paying more and more attention to the research and practice related to the protection of large-scale heritage.The "heritage corridor" as a new idea of heritage protection following the current development trend has become a research hotspot.The renewal of mining areas,the transformation of coal mine industrial enterprises and urban planning are not coordinated.For mining areas,economic development is lagging behind,the historical pattern is impacted,and residents' senseof identity and belonging are weakened.For urban development,mining areas become urban renewal.The obstacles for the coal mine resource-based cities are the decline of mines and the decline of cities.Theoretical research: from a macro perspective,sort out the development pattern of China 's coal mine industrial heritage and put forward the theoretical basis for the construction of China 's coal mine industrial heritage protection pattern under the concept of “heritage corridor”,and point out the strategic research value of Jinpu Railway as an important heritage corridor.By analyzing the regional characteristics of the Zaozhuang section along the Jinpu Railway,the necessity and inevitability of carrying out research on the protection of the industrial heritage of Zaozhuang Coal Mine is put forward,and combined with the reading of historical materials,investigation and interviews,the Zaozhuang Coal Mine industrial heritage,the mining area's ecological environment,and the heritage-related social and cultural factors are investigated And log in as data support to carry out relevant research.Method exploration: Analyze the predicament of Zaozhuang coal mine industrial enterprise itself and the level of urban transformation,and put forward the research method of "mine-city" collaboration.Use GIS technology to construct a value evaluation model to evaluate and grade the coal mine industrial heritage within the scope of registration as the theoretical basis and value orientation for constructing a global,integral and scientific coal mine industrial heritage protection pattern.Construction of the pattern: First,the goal principle of the adaptive protection and utilization of the industrial heritage of Zaozhuang Coal Mine under the concept of“heritage corridor” is proposed.Secondly,the industrial heritage cultural corridor and green corridor of the Zaozhuang section of the Jinpu Railway along the Jinpu Railway will be constructed according to the heritage value grade,together with relevant non-material The integration of cultural heritage to form an overall protection pattern.Strategy proposed: According to the development characteristics of the overall protection pattern of coal mine industrial heritage in Zaozhuang section of Jinpu railway,this paper studies the protection and utilization strategies of coal mine industrial heritage in Zaozhuang section from three aspects of "the renewal of coal mine industrial heritage gathering area-the transformation of Coal Mine Industrial Enterprises-the reuse of related buildings and structures of coal mine industry".Combining with the development planning of Zaozhuang City,this paper putsforward the coal mine industry from a macro perspective The mechanism of coordinated renewal and development of gathering areas and cities is proposed.The strategy of transformation of coal mining industry enterprises and coordinated development of cities at the economic,environmental and cultural levels is put forward from the perspective of the medium and even the micro perspective.The scheme of reuse of coal mining industry related buildings and urban innovation and development is proposed.On this basis,the specific implementation of relevant planning strategies is analyzed based on practical cases Case.
